Nintendo continues to enrich its retro catalog with an arrival that does not go unnoticed. Pokémon XD Gale of Darkness is now available on Nintendo Switch Online, provided you have the Expansion Pack.
Initially released in 2005 on GameCube, this iconic RPG joins the library of games accessible via the dedicated application on Switch 2. An announcement which comes a few weeks after its confirmation during Pokémon Day.
Pokémon XD on Switch Online, a GameCube classic available now
With this arrival, subscribers can dive back into the universe of Orre, a region marked by dark Pokémon to be purified. The game offers an experience faithful to the third generation, with turn-based combat mechanics and abilities influencing clashes.
To access it, you must have a Nintendo Switch Online subscription with the Expansion Pack. The latter provides access to several retro catalogs, including the GameCube, exclusive to the Switch 2.

An important limitation to know before playing
Despite this expected return, a key functionality is missing. Back in the GameCube era, the game allowed you to connect a Game Boy Advance to transfer Pokémon. This option is not available on Switch Online. It is therefore impossible to transfer creatures to other modern games or services like Pokémon HOME. This absence limits certain interactions, but does not prevent you from fully enjoying the main adventure.
